
In the heart of town, a sort-of Little Japan has opened up where patrons can feast and experience the full succulent armada of authentic Japanese cuisine.

Wisma Atria's Japan Food Town opened its doors to much fanfare, announcing the arrival of 16 bona fide Japanese kitchens, restaurants and bars in a 20,075 sq ft space. But this is no mere collection of Japanese restaurants — the aesthetics come into play as well.